Abstract
"MéTODO DE ANTI-OXIDAçãO E áGUA QUE FUNCIONA COMO ANTI-OXIDANTE". Um método de anti-oxidação e água que funciona como anti-oxidante que pode transformar um objeto de anti-oxidação que está em um estado de oxidação devido a uma deficiência de elétrons, ou para qual proteção de oxidação é desejada, em um estado reduzido onde elétrons são satisfeitos, pela promoção da reação de quebra de hidrogênio molecular que é usado como um substrato incluído em água dissolvida em hidrogênio em um produto de hidrogênio ativo através de um processo empregando um catalisador na água dissolvida em hidrogênio, enquanto antecipa altas marcas de nível de segurança no corpo humano, e carga ambiental reduzida.
